Tim Reynolds: The Underrated Master of Multi-Instrumentalism
A Brief Introduction
Tim Reynolds, born on December 15, 1957, is an American guitarist and multi-instrumentalist renowned for his exceptional skill and versatility. As the lead guitarist for the
Dave Matthews Band, Reynolds has left an indelible mark on the music industry, earning him the title of "underrated master" by AllMusic critic MacKenzie Wilson.

The Genesis of TR3 and the Dave Matthews Band
Reynolds' association with the Dave Matthews Band began when he befriended a young Dave Matthews, then a bartender at Millers in Charlottesville, Virginia. Reynolds encouraged Matthews to form his own band, introducing him to local musicians who would eventually become core members of the Dave Matthews Band. Although Reynolds declined the offer to join the band initially, he went on to record and tour with them as a sideman from its inception until 1998. He officially joined the band in 2008.
Early Life and Inspirations
Born in Wiesbaden, Germany, to a U.S. Army family, Reynolds spent his childhood moving frequently between Germany, Indiana, Alaska, Kansas, and Missouri. His devout Christian upbringing surrounded him with Christian music, but it was his older sister's Beatles albums that sparked his passion for music at a young age. Reynolds learned guitar and bass guitar to perform in his family's local church choir, eventually experimenting with other instruments.
Touring and Collaborations
Apart from his work with the Dave Matthews Band, Reynolds has toured as an acoustic duo with Dave Matthews and performed as a member of Dave Matthews & Friends. He has also founded his own band, TR3, further showcasing his instrumental prowess.
